Warning Signs You Need Wet Vacuum Water Extraction
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Be aware of the following signs and take action quickly: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ty smell can show moisture buildup in your home. This can lead to mold growth and further damage.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Water damage can cause floors to warp or buckle. Don’t wait until it’s too late, address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Visible Water Stains
Water stains on walls or ceilings can be a sign of underlying moisture issues. Don’t ignore these signs, address the issue before it becomes a major problem.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show moisture issues in your home. Don’t wait until it’s too late, address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Unpleasant Smells from Your HVAC System
An unpleasant smell from your HVAC system can show moisture buildup in your ductwork. Don’t ignore this sign, address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Water Damage in Your Attic or Crawl Space
Water damage in your attic or crawl space can lead to major problems if left unchecked. Don’t wait until it’s too late, address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Wet Vacuum Water Extraction Cost in Midway City, CA
The cost of Wet Vacuum Water Extraction services in Midway City, CA, varies based on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the specifics of your situ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Planning |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of the issue |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and amount of water present |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and extent of moisture damage |
| Monitoring and Follow-up |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of the issue |
| Specialized Equipment and Techniques |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and extent of damage |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a customized plan that fits your budget and needs.
